OPERATING DEVICE FOR HUMAN POWERED VEHICLE

    Abstract: An operating device for a human powered vehicle comprises a base member and an operating member configured to be movably coupled to the base member. A controller is configured to generate an operation signal in response to an operation of an electrical switch. An electric generator is configured to generate electric power in response to the operation of the electrical switch. A power storage is configured to store the electric power generated by the electric generator. The electrical switch and the electric generator is provided on a first location. The power storage is provided on a second location different from the first location. The second location is defined on at least one of the operating member and a surface of the base member.

    Abstract: A bicycle electrical component assembly is basically provided with a bicycle electrical component, a power supply unit and a power supply bracket. The bicycle electrical component includes a movable member and an electrical actuation unit. The electrical actuation unit includes an electrical actuator that is operatively coupled to the movable member to actuate the movable member. The power supply unit is electrically connected to the electrical actuation unit to supply an electrical power to the electrical actuation unit. The power supply bracket is configured to mount the power supply unit to the bicycle electrical component. At least one of the power supply unit and the power supply bracket includes at least one of an electrical cable and an electrical port that is configured to be connected to an electrical cable.

    Abstract: A control device is provided for controlling a human-powered vehicle. The control device includes an electronic controller configured to control a motor that applies a propulsion force to the human-powered vehicle. In a case where a predetermined condition is satisfied, the electronic controller is configured to increase at least one of an assist level of the motor, a maximum value of an output of the motor, and the output of the motor. The predetermined condition includes a first condition in which deceleration of the human-powered vehicle in a traveling direction of the human-powered vehicle is greater than or equal to a first threshold value.

    Abstract: A bicycle electric system comprises a first electric component, a second electric component, and a second controller. The first electric component includes a first controller and a sensor. The first controller is configured to control an operating status of the first electric component based on an output of the sensor. The second electric component is different from the first electric component. At least one of the first electric component and the second electric component includes an electric suspension. The second controller is configured to control an operating status of the second electric component based on the output of the sensor of the first electric component.
